Q: Is 223,313,504 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 223,313,504 is a composite number.

Why is 223,313,504 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 223,313,504 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 32 6,978,547 13,957,094 27,914,188 55,828,376 111,656,752 and 223,313,504, with no remainder.

Since 223,313,504 cannot be divided by just 1 and 223,313,504, it is a composite number.
